Final Fantasy VII, VIII, IX get Physical Releases Announced, Final Fantasy VII Remake & Rebirth Twin Pack Also AnnouncedOctober 9, 2025
News Atomfall Hits 1.5 Milion Players, Most Successful Game In Developer Rebellion’s HistoryBy Zach BarbieriApril 1, 2025 Atomfall, the post-apocalyptic action game set amid the ruins of 1962 London, has proven successful as it reaches 1.5 million…